Fuzzy Based PFC Bridgeless Dual Converter Fed BLDC Motor Drive

Abstract

This paper shows another PFC bridgeless (BL) buck–boost converter for brushless direct current (BLDC) engine drive application in low-control applications. A Fuzzy logic execution in adaptable speed control of BLDC engine is done here. A methodology of rate control of the BLDC engine by controlling the dc bus voltage of the voltage source inverter (VSI) is utilized with a solitary voltage sensor. The controller is intended to track varieties of pace references and settles the yield velocity amid burden varieties. The BLDC has a few preferences contrast with the other kind of engines; however the nonlinearity of t he BLDC engine drive attributes, in light of the fact that it is hard to handle by utilizing customary relative basic (PI) controller. So as to tackle this fundamental issue, the Fuzzy logic control turns into a suitable control. To give an inborn PFC at supply ac mains a converter based on buck-boost type is intended to work in broken inductor current mode (DICM). The execution of the proposed commute is mimicked in MATLAB/ Simulink environment.
